Council approves warrants, accepts county lifeguard grant funds and extends environmental monitoring at 30 Main Street

Summary

The Ogdensburg City Council approved its consent warrants, accepted a portion of a county lifeguard grant, authorized continued environmental monitoring at 30 Main Street, and voted to go into executive session on personnel matters.

The Ogdensburg City Council voted on routine warrants and three agenda items during the meeting.

Consent warrants: The council approved the consent agenda, which included general fund warrant number 8‑2025 in the amount of $592,311.60; capital fund warrant number 8‑2025 in the amount of $22,894.50; and community development fund warrant number 8‑2025 in the amount of $75.98.
